Output fc24d5bd4e021cd28400afc7fd673ba502baeeb110cc02ccf2b2c51978b75c91:0

value
16107126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ef9d0ea5bf7c874a7130a52d1ed7c099fd6568d8 OP_EQUAL
address
3PXyZvCDXAotDhp8NuqvGCDmBWaSFMBjpA
transaction
fc24d5bd4e021cd28400afc7fd673ba502baeeb110cc02ccf2b2c51978b75c91
confirmations
349614
spent
true